Thermoformed Plastic Trays | Thermoforming – Universal Plastics
Product Details: Custom thermoformed plastic trays manufactured by Universal Plastics, specializing in heavy gauge thermoforming with capabilities up to 12′ x 9′ part sizes.
Technical Parameters:
– Materials: PVC, HDPE, PE, PETG, HIPS, RPET
– Size capability: Up to 12′ x 9′
– Manufacturing processes: Vacuum forming, pressure forming, twin sheet forming
– Equipment: 22 pressure formers, 14 vacuum formers, 26 5-axis trimming machines
– Secondary services: In-house tooling, engineering, finishing services, automotiv…
Application Scenarios:
– Shipping trays for electronics, medical, precision components
– Material handling trays for manufacturing processes
– Pick & place trays for assembly
– Part protection trays for delicate items
– ESD protection trays for electronics
– Automation trays for high-tech manufacturing
– Medical trays for specialized applications
– Drip trays for chemical containment

Custom Plastic Trays – Ready-Made
Product Details: Ready-Made custom plastic trays designed to meet exact specifications with options for color, pocket dimensions, and material thickness.
Technical Parameters:
– Pocket dimensions up to 2 inches deep
– Material thicknesses: 0.03, 0.05, and 0.06 inches
– Available tray sizes: 10-5/8 x 10-5/8 inches, 11 x 7-1/2 inches, 14 x 7-1/4 inch…
Application Scenarios:
– Medical industry for shipping medical parts
– Aerospace and mechanical parts manufacturing
Pros:
– Customizable in color and dimensions
– Made in the USA with domestically sourced materials
– Bulk-pricing discounts available
Cons:
– Minimum order quantity of 1,000 for the first tray order
– Long lead times for custom designs (4-8 weeks)
